British Coins, George III, proof farthing, 1806, plain edge, struck in gold, laur. and dr. bust r., rev. Britannia std. l., holding trident and olive branch (S.3782; W&R.175; P.1392), certified and graded by NGC as Proof 61, extremely rare
Believed to be from descendants of the Boulton family, and the last one we can trace is the Pitman specimen from 1999 offered for sale
